    Dyna Glo Wide Vertical Offset Question

    Has anyone here installed a BBQ guru fan to this offset smoker? If so, how exactly did you do it? I know this is a super cheap pit compared to what a lot of you have. I don't know if it's worth doing the mod or not.

    I've had good luck with the performance of the smoker but I've been babysitting it a lot and no longer have the time to do that. Thanks for any help or suggestions.

    I'm also not opposed to replacing it if that's a better decision. Just can't spend more than $800 and want the charcoal flavor without all of the work.

    #2
    The BBQ Guru and other ATC's are all about air control. That will be tough to accomplish on a Dyna Glo. I'm sure that you are producing great food on it anyway and babysitting is fun some times. If you want to add a hands-off smoker to the arsenal that will work really well with a Guru look at the Weber Smokey Mountain- (330 for the 18 and 430 for the 22). I run my WSM with a controller and I get 12-13 hours straight without touching it. I know of people that get much longer times but that's a mystery to me and 12 is plenty for me.
